Here are the best vitamin B12 injection sites for each method: Subcutaneous B12 injection sites Usually, the best places to give yourself a B12 shot subcutaneously are the abdomen, thigh, and upper arm, as you can see in this illustration: Although not shown above, the buttock is another good site for B12 shots
The Typical Starting Dose of 1000 mcg (1 mg) The usual first dose for adults is 1000 mcg (1 mg) of vitamin B12
